From 06d9934b853534cf4d05499bf334a8b71534edbb Mon Sep 17 00:00:00 2001 From: Norbert Fabritius Date: Tue, 11 Apr 2023 15:40:05 +0200 Subject: [PATCH] all.sh: Add component testing default minus session tickets Signed-off-by: Norbert Fabritius Signed-off-by: Ronald Cron --- tests/scripts/all.sh |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/tests/scripts/all.sh b/tests/scripts/all.sh index a1203f7726..7953b1cc48 100755 --- a/tests/scripts/all.sh +++ b/tests/scripts/all.sh @@ -6061,6 +6061,17 @@ component_test_tls13_no_compatibility_mode () { tests/ssl-opt.sh } +component_test_default_minus_session_tickets() { + msg "build: default config without session tickets" + scripts/config.py unset MBEDTLS_SSL_SESSION_TICKETS + CC=gcc cmake -D CMAKE_BUILD_TYPE:String=Asan . + make + msg "test: default config without session tickets" + make test + msg "ssl-opt.sh (default config without session tickets)" + tests/ssl-opt.sh +} + component_build_mingw () { msg "build: Windows cross build - mingw64, make (Link Library)" # ~ 30s make CC=i686-w64-mingw32-gcc AR=i686-w64-mingw32-ar LD=i686-w64-minggw32-ld CFLAGS='-Werror -Wall -Wextra -maes -msse2 -mpclmul' WINDOWS_BUILD=1 lib programs